Service Description
Join artist Em Campbell for a relaxed outdoor watercolor experience where you'll learn how to paint “in the wild.” This 2-hour session is designed for all skill levels—from complete beginners to painters looking to loosen up and try painting outdoors. Working in a small group at a local park, Em will guide you through the essentials of painting on location. You’ll learn how to choose a subject, simplify a scene, and capture the feeling of a place without getting overwhelmed by detail. Along the way you'll explore practical skills that make outdoor painting easier and more enjoyable. Topics include: • simple outdoor watercolor setup and supplies • choosing a paintable subject • basic composition for landscapes • working with a limited palette • adapting to changing light • keeping your painting loose and efficient Participants will create a small landscape painting during the workshop and leave with the confidence to continue painting outdoors on their own.
